Description

Human Made is a Japanese fashion label, founded by fashion designer and music producer/DJ NIGO, in 2010. NIGO started up this brand in order to create things he was not able to with his revolutionary, trendsetting streetwear brand - A Bathing Ape (BAPE). With graphic designer Sk8thing, Human Made ventured into creating whimsical pieces of both quality and authenticity to reflect the pre-1960’s.
